Abstract
The dynamics of rates of maternal, infant and perinatal mortality in Russian federation is presented in this article. The reasons of infant mortality were analyzed. The results of realization of federal principal program «children of Russia» and subprogram «healthy child» in 2003–2006 years, and measures of priority state project in health service sphere in directions «neonatal screening» and «delivery certification» were given. For the purpose of further decrease of rates of maternal and infant mortality it is necessary to strengthen a material and technical basis of institutions of maternity and childhood, to create a system of perinatal centers, to raise an accessibility of high tech types of medical service, to organize training of personnel, to develop a prophylactic direction of medical service.
Key words: maternal mortality, infant mortality, neonatal screening, high tech medical service.
